Output 01d56bb37772df63b7f57934541870f4c90511a2f543d0fe3a6f169cf9e8687c:7

value
8357581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 267aa6b2209aaf70f0be283744f200a182c95bb4 OP_EQUAL
address
MBQcqftwQvgSQ3dJVXDoEW6zvVtP1pSb3x
transaction
01d56bb37772df63b7f57934541870f4c90511a2f543d0fe3a6f169cf9e8687c
spent
true